Q: Is 4,654,056 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 4,654,056 is a composite number.

Why is 4,654,056 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 4,654,056 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 8 11 12 17 22 24 33 34 44 51 61 66 68 88 102 122 132 136 183 187 204 244 264 289 366 374 408 488 561 578 671 732 748 867 1,037 1,122 1,156 1,342 1,464 1,496 1,734 2,013 2,074 2,244 2,312 2,684 3,111 3,179 3,468 4,026 4,148 4,488 5,368 6,222 6,358 6,936 8,052 8,296 9,537 11,407 12,444 12,716 16,104 17,629 19,074 22,814 24,888 25,432 34,221 35,258 38,148 45,628 52,887 68,442 70,516 76,296 91,256 105,774 136,884 141,032 193,919 211,548 273,768 387,838 423,096 581,757 775,676 1,163,514 1,551,352 2,327,028 and 4,654,056, with no remainder.

Since 4,654,056 cannot be divided by just 1 and 4,654,056, it is a composite number.
